The QST-2002HF is an engineering test system for characterizing the
performance of MR Heads at the Head Gimbal Assembly level at magnetic
fields up to 15,000 Oe
Low Frequency measurements include Resistance and Transfer Curve analysis.
High Frequency measurements include the most advanced instability
detection system available today. These measurements, performed through
our unique HF channel with integrated digital scope, include Popcorn, HF
Noise, and patented Spectral Maximum Amplitude Noise (SMAN).
The ultra high range of the QST-2002HF allows observation of sensor
characteristics such as pin layer reversal and demagnetization in extreme
conditions. It is capable of resetting the hard magnetic layer at HGA and
HSA level by applying extremely high longitudinal magnetic field. Other
applications include initialization investigation and environmental
robustness.
The full suite of stress conditions include field up to 15000 Oe, write
current to 60 mA 0-pk , bias current to 20 mA, full DFH exercise, and
elevated temperature.
With standard ISI open architecture design software using ActiveX™
technology, customers can develop and revise their own custom tests in
minutes with Visual Basic™.
